Two batches; one with Experimental XJA/2436 hops and one with Tropic hops blended together and then dry-hopped with Sublime hops. All three hops from South Africa.

Poured into the test glass from a 16 oz can purchased at the brewery 2 days prior.
A - Goldenrod colored backdrop, hazy and transluscent. Backlit this glows beautifully. Carbonation feeds a loose knit white froth. Lacing is stratacumulus.
S - Earthy, hint of chive or green onion, very slight, then the tropics roll in, papaya, dragon fruit, kiwi. Add a floral green tea and thats the start.
T - Sweet malts, cracker, green tea, again the tropics and earthy threads are all in there.
M - A bit slick, medium in body, dry finish, linger has a white pepper quality which I really like. The balance between sweet, fruity and bitter is remarkable.
O - My first of this series, glad to have this version, really complex and challenging hop profile. A pleasure on the palate, with a delightful body, and aromatics that are like a trip to a tropical plant greenhouse.

16 oz. can packaged the beginning of this week.
Moderate pour yields a one inch white head over a very slightly hazy golden body with lacing. Nice nose of tropical fruit and slight pine with a bit of floral/herbal aromas as well. As it warms, there is also a bit of coconut on the nose with some pungent wet leaf aspects. Taste of all kinds of tropical fruit (lychee, pineapple, mango), a little bergamot, and even some plum-like flavors as well. Wow, very complex as it warms and so unique! Requisite Skadoosh feel and overall, a yet another home run in the Skadoosh series from The Alchemist.
